EVERY WINTER
I have finally been to Glasgow.
It was December and it was dark.
I saw reflections of myself on the shop windows,
I followed the neon signs.
I was feeling distant and absent-minded
before I got to know about you.
On that winter night
you went out when it was already dark,
to get a breath of fresh air and take pictures.
You reached a half-empty square,
only a carousel, a few guys,
and some crows looking for food.
They asked you why were you taking pictures,
they told you to delete them,
they told you they didn't want to be in them.
They chased you, they reached you right before the bridge,
they threw you to the ground, they kicked you and made you apologize.
When you raised from the ground, a confused murmur all around you:
"We did not want to meddle, we thought it was your boyfriend,
we didn't know they were strangers or else we would have stopped them.
But we thought it was just your boyfriend with his friends".
Glasgow gets cold in December,
I will always be far away from this city,
even when I walk in the center.
A few months later
I saw that picture:
I couldn’t see anyone,
just a few lights on a black background.
Every winter it gets dark early,
every winter people stay home
and every winter the streets are empty,
every winter, the shadows in the avenues.
Glasgow gets cold in December,
when my mind is somewhere else
and my pocket is heavy.
